Neil Flynn was before my time, and on the early Bradley speech teams of the 70's. He was teammates with Tim Gamble, who has a long movie career playing character roles in films like Hoffa, The Untouchables, and perhaps most memorably for you folks with tweenie girls, Molly Ringwald's father in The Breakfast Club. Tim Gamble's son Mason played Dennis The Menace in the film with Walter Matthau.
One of my heroes and mentors is Douglas R. Springer, early Bradley debater and forensics star, currently the Director of Debate and Forensics at New Trier High School. When I was in college, I worked for Springer as an assistant coach. My wife knows that if Springer hasn't retired before my ten year-old reaches high school, we're buying the smallest condo they sell in Winnetka, so he can learn from Springer. |
